Product Overview

Category: Integrated Circuits (ICs)

Use: Voltage References

Characteristics: - Low voltage reference - Adjustable output voltage - High accuracy and stability - Low temperature coefficient - Low power consumption

Package: SOT-23-3

Essence: The AZ431AZ-ATRE1 is a precision shunt regulator that provides a stable voltage reference. It is commonly used in various electronic circuits where a precise and stable voltage reference is required.

Working Principles

The AZ431AZ-ATRE1 operates as a shunt regulator, maintaining a stable output voltage by shunting excess current to ground. By adjusting the external resistors connected to the reference pin, the desired output voltage can be set within the specified range.
